Haplogroup
Descriptions |
|
C3 The C3 lineage is believed to
have originated in southeast or central Asia. This lineage
then spread into northern Asia, and then into the
Americas. |
| |
|
E This lineage originates in
Africa and is restricted to African populations. |
| |
|
G This lineage may have
originated in India or Pakistan, and has dispersed into
central Asia, Europe, and the Middle East. The G2 branch of
this lineage (containing the P15 mutation) is found most often
in the Europe and the Middle East. |
| |
|
G2 This lineage may have
originated in India or Pakistan, and has dispersed into
central Asia, Europe, and the Middle East. The G2 branch of
this lineage (containing the P15 mutation) is found most often
in the Europe and the Middle East. |
| |
|
I Haplogroup I dates to 23,000
years ago or longer. Lineages not in branches I1a, I1b or I1c
are found distributed at low frequency throughout
Europe. |
| |
|
I1a The I1a lineage likely has
its roots in northern France. Today it is found most
frequently within Viking / Scandinavian populations in
northwest Europe and has since spread down into Central and
Eastern Europe, where it is found at low
frequencies. |
| |
|
I1a1 The I1a lineage likely has
its roots in Northern France. Today it is found most
frequently within Viking / Scandinavian populations in
northwest Europe and has since spread down into Central and
Eastern Europe, where it is found at low
frequencies. |
| |
|
I1a4 The I1a lineage likely has
its roots in northern France and is found most frequently
found today within Viking / Scandinavian populations in
northwest Europe. Its I1a4 branch is found scattered in
eastern and southeastern Europe. |
| |
|
I1b The Balkan countries likely
harbored this subgroup of I during the Last Glacial Maximum.
Today, this branch is found distributed in the Balkans and
Eastern Europe, and extends further east with Slavic-speaking
populations. |
| |
|
I1c The I1c lineage likely has
its roots in northern France. Today it is found most
frequently within Viking / Scandinavian populations in
Northwest Europe and extends at low frequencies into Central
and Eastern Europe. |
| |
|
O2 Haplogroup O2 has two primary
lines, the 465 line and the M95 line. Both lines are found in
Asia. The 465 line is at high frequency in Japanese and Korean
populations and at low frequency in east Asia. The M95 line is
found in Southeast Asian populations (Malaysia, Vietnam,
Indonesia, and southern China) |
